karrot-frontend icon indicating copy to clipboard operation
karrot-frontend copied to clipboard

Feedback to be given only after an activity ends

Open brnsolikyl opened this issue 4 years ago • 8 comments

The behavior now is that Karrot prompts you to give feedback to an activity right after it has started.

The proposal is that feedback can be given only after the activity has ended. For activities that do not have an end time, there seems to be a default of half an hour.

Quoting Nick:

we mark the activities is_done=True by checking for date__startswith__lt=timezone.now() which seems like it should be date__endswith__lt=timezone.now()

brnsolikyl avatar Sep 12 '20 15:09 brnsolikyl

We had more discussion in rocket chat about it here --> https://chat.foodsaving.world/channel/karrot-dev?msg=pDCYemqn5b9F56F4x

I made this suggestion, which seemed to be accepted:

So maybe have it so max delay for being able to give feedback is 1h after it starts.

For activities less than 1h that would mean you can only feedback after the end.

For ones longer than 1h you can give feedback 1h after it starts.

nicksellen avatar Nov 22 '20 12:11 nicksellen

This issue is marked as stale because it has not had any activity for 90 days.

It doesn't mean it's not important, so please remove the stale label if you like it, or add a comment saying what it means to you :)

However, if you just leave it like this, I'll close it in 7 days to help keep your issues tidy!

Thanks!

github-actions[bot] avatar Feb 21 '21 00:02 github-actions[bot]

Damn bot! Although for this issue another round of 90 days might be useful. Next time I'll let the bot do its thing.

brnsolikyl avatar Mar 08 '21 18:03 brnsolikyl

The Freiburg group is now working on it.

pogopaule avatar Apr 08 '21 08:04 pogopaule

This issue is marked as stale because it has not had any activity for 90 days.

It doesn't mean it's not important, so please remove the stale label if you like it, or add a comment saying what it means to you :)

However, if you just leave it like this, I'll close it in 7 days to help keep your issues tidy!

Thanks!

github-actions[bot] avatar Jul 18 '21 00:07 github-actions[bot]

This issue is marked as stale because it has not had any activity for 90 days.

It doesn't mean it's not important, so please remove the stale label if you like it, or add a comment saying what it means to you :)

However, if you just leave it like this, I'll close it in 7 days to help keep your issues tidy!

Thanks!

github-actions[bot] avatar Oct 17 '21 00:10 github-actions[bot]

This issue is marked as stale because it has not had any activity for 90 days.

It doesn't mean it's not important, so please remove the stale label if you like it, or add a comment saying what it means to you :)

However, if you just leave it like this, I'll close it in 7 days to help keep your issues tidy!

Thanks!

github-actions[bot] avatar Jan 16 '22 01:01 github-actions[bot]

This issue is marked as stale because it has not had any activity for 180 days.

If it's still important for you add a comment saying what it means to you, remove the stale label, and/or add the "important" label :)

However, if you just leave it like this, I'll close it in 30 days to help keep your issues relevant!

Thanks!

github-actions[bot] avatar Sep 12 '22 02:09 github-actions[bot]